Galaxy Express 999 train, Furusato-Ginga line, Hokkaido
Characters from Leiji Matsumoto’s “Galaxy Express 999″ anime/manga adorn this train that used to run on the Furusato-Ginga line in Hokkaido. The train line closed down in 2006.

Pink ninja train, Iga line, Mie prefecture
Matsumoto also created a series of ninja train designs for the Iga line in Mie prefecture, the birthplace of ninjutsu.

Some trains on the Kakogawa line in Hyōgo prefecture feature designs by graphic artist Tadanori Yokoo. Yokoo was born in Hyōgo.

Doraemon train, Seikan Tunnel Tappi Shakō Line, Hokkaido
This Doraemon train runs back and forth through the Seikan Tunnel, an undersea railway connecting Honshu and Hokkaido.

Kitarō train, Tottori line, Tottori prefecture
Trains on the Tottori line in Tottori prefecture are decorated with characters from Shigeru Mizuki’s “GeGeGe no Kitarō” manga/anime series. Mizuki was born in Tottori prefecture.

Cyborg 009 train, Senseki line, Miyagi prefecture
Miyagi prefecture is the birthplace of manga/anime artist Ishinomori Shōtarō, whose works include Cyborg 009 and the Kamen Rider Series. Some of his characters adorn trains on the Senseki line.

Pichon-kun on the Skytrain, Bangkok, Thailand
Japanese characters can occasionally be found on trains in other countries. This photo shows Pichon-kun, the robot mascot of Japanese air-conditioning manufacturer Daikin, on the side of the Skytrain in Bangkok, Thailand.
